The asymmetric unit of the title compound, [Co(C 12 H 8 N 2 ) 3 ](I 3 ) 2 , contains one [Co(1,10‐phenanthroline) 3 ] 2+ cation, half each of two centrosymmetric triiodide anions, and one complete triiodide anion. The title compound was synthesized solvothermally from Co(NO 3 ) 2 , 1,10‐phenanthroline, and SnI 2 , where the SnI 2 reagent serves only as a source of I atoms.
